Strengthen the female mind by enlarging it, and there will be an end to blind obedience.

Quotes by Mary Wollstonecraft

The capacity of the female mind for studies of the highest order cannot be doubted, having been sufficiently illustrated by its works of genius, of erudition, and of science.

Quotes by James Madison
